The optimum process mean and screening limits are provided for a production process where the accepted item is sold in one of two alternative markets and the rejected item is reworked. All items are subject to screening where the screening variable may be the major quality characteristic of interest (performance variable) or the surrogate variable, which is highly correlated with the performance variable. Abstract Results from a northcentral Louisiana loblolly pine (Pinus taeda) site (site index 94, base age 25) showed that seedling grade affected survival, height, and volume production. Survival of Grade 1 seedlings was significantly greater than cull seedlings and volume production from Grade 1 seedlings was 17.5% greater than that of Grade 2 seedlings. The present value of the additional wood produced at age 13 by Grade 1 seedlings (over that of Grade 2 seedlings) ranged from $50 to $139 per thousand seedlings. Biweekly Grade A and manufacturing grade herd milk samples were collected from April 1, 1985, to March 31, 1986, from 203 herds in the Sioux Falls, SD, area and were analyzed to compare composition. The average herd milk composition was 3.70% fat, 3.24% protein, 4.80% lactose, 0.63% ash, 8.67% solids-not-fat (SNF), and 12.37% total solids (TS). Grade A milk had higher % lactose (4.83 and 4.76), % SNF (8.70 and 8.61), and % TS (12.41 and 12.30) than manufacturing grade milk.
